Output 321aeee55154a62e9963e7d34153dc0eaca86996b09e630a32e655e34ada4732:73

value
771367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b271424be9a4d1c5cecf669e0142a05b4fe527 OP_EQUAL
address
3CWdRaNuc3riheHGFu88JKfDJ5voB2qEon
transaction
321aeee55154a62e9963e7d34153dc0eaca86996b09e630a32e655e34ada4732
spent
true